Amethyst Lemmy
  • Communities
  • Create Post
  • Create Community
  • heart
    Support Lemmy
  • search
    Search
  • Login
  • Sign Up
not_IO@lemmy.blahaj.zone to Programmer Humor@programming.devEnglish · 2 days ago

megabool

lemmy.blahaj.zone

message-square
37
link
fedilink
429

megabool

lemmy.blahaj.zone

not_IO@lemmy.blahaj.zone to Programmer Humor@programming.devEnglish · 2 days ago
message-square
37
link
fedilink

https://infosec.exchange/@catsalad/112133060746939956

https://en.wikipedia.org/wiki/Truth_table

alert-triangle
You must log in or # to comment.
  • smaximov@lemmy.world
    link
    fedilink
    arrow-up
    40
    ·
    2 days ago

    BIG_IF_TRUE

  • fruitcantfly@programming.dev
    link
    fedilink
    arrow-up
    17
    ·
    2 days ago

    I prefer the classic Bool:

    enum Bool 
    { 
        True, 
        False, 
        FileNotFound 
    };
    
    • noughtnaut@lemmy.world
      link
      fedilink
      arrow-up
      2
      ·
      edit-2
      1 day ago

      If this classic isn’t linked from that Wikipedia article (I never checked) it really should be. Like the “static cling” image, evnen encyclopedias need to know when to step out of formal style. 🤭

    • DasFaultier@sh.itjust.works
      link
      fedilink
      English
      arrow-up
      6
      ·
      2 days ago

      Ah yes, the three genders.

  • toynbee@piefed.social
    link
    fedilink
    English
    arrow-up
    50
    ·
    2 days ago

    Yes, no, maybe, I don’t know, can you repeat the question?

    • SkunkWorkz@lemmy.world
      link
      fedilink
      arrow-up
      9
      ·
      2 days ago

    • Aurenkin@sh.itjust.works
      link
      fedilink
      arrow-up
      8
      ·
      2 days ago

      You’re not the boss of me, now!

    • Zoop@beehaw.org
      link
      fedilink
      arrow-up
      2
      ·
      2 days ago

      You’re not the boss of me now! You’re not the boss of me now! You’re not the boss of me now, and you’re not so big! Life is unfair…

      • toynbee@piefed.social
        link
        fedilink
        English
        arrow-up
        2
        ·
        2 days ago

        Stop singing and get back to work.

    • Klear@piefed.world
      link
      fedilink
      English
      arrow-up
      2
      ·
      2 days ago

      Splunge!

      • toynbee@piefed.social
        link
        fedilink
        English
        arrow-up
        3
        ·
        2 days ago

        I’m curious of what that means, but that link put me through five captchas in a row and I ran out of patience.

        • Klear@piefed.world
          link
          fedilink
          English
          arrow-up
          4
          ·
          2 days ago

          Youtube is giving you captchas? Ouch.

          It’s a Monty Python sketch. Here it is in text form.

          • toynbee@piefed.social
            link
            fedilink
            English
            arrow-up
            4
            ·
            2 days ago

            Thanks! I’m on a VPN using graphene, so that’s probably why YouTube doesn’t like me.

  • Yorick@piefed.social
    link
    fedilink
    English
    arrow-up
    25
    ·
    2 days ago

    May I introduce the VHDL STD library where you can set an output to “don’t care”:

    Wikipedia IEEE-1164

    As an embedded electronics engineer discovering VHDL was a blast and a mindfuck!

    • white_nrdy@programming.dev
      link
      fedilink
      arrow-up
      13
      ·
      2 days ago

      Don’t worry, VHDL is still a mindfuck sometimes even after being an FPGA engineer for years (mostly only using VHDL). It’s such a cool language, and I am glad you discovered and are enjoying it!

    • blibla@slrpnk.net
      link
      fedilink
      arrow-up
      1
      ·
      1 day ago

      its just what most people what vall illegal state or impossible?

  • RustyNova@lemmy.world
    link
    fedilink
    arrow-up
    41
    ·
    2 days ago

    Missing the truth nuke

    • Klear@piefed.world
      link
      fedilink
      English
      arrow-up
      33
      ·
      2 days ago

      And DAMN_LIE

      • floquant@lemmy.dbzer0.com
        link
        fedilink
        arrow-up
        28
        ·
        2 days ago

        FAKE_NEWS (true but I don’t like it)

        • Klear@piefed.world
          link
          fedilink
          English
          arrow-up
          8
          ·
          2 days ago

          I also propose a new binary operator CARES_ABOUT_YOUR_FEELINGS

      • nimisnimi@lemmy.ca
        link
        fedilink
        arrow-up
        6
        ·
        2 days ago

        MEGABULL ,

      • BlackRoseAmongThorns@slrpnk.net
        link
        fedilink
        arrow-up
        2
        ·
        2 days ago

        and megabool::Statistics

  • Elvith Ma'for@feddit.org
    link
    fedilink
    arrow-up
    26
    ·
    2 days ago

    DOUBLE_PLUS_UNTRUE

  • lime!@feddit.nu
    link
    fedilink
    arrow-up
    16
    ·
    2 days ago

    missing the classic

  • jballs@sh.itjust.works
    link
    fedilink
    English
    arrow-up
    7
    ·
    2 days ago

    While working on some client code, my coworker and I came across a case statement that said something like

    if myBoolean == TRUE
    then blah
    else if myBoolean == FALSE
    then blah blah
    else if myBoolean is null
    then blah blah blah
    

    Ever since we’ve always laughed at the “trinary bit”.

  • ChaoticNeutralCzech@feddit.org
    link
    fedilink
    English
    arrow-up
    12
    ·
    edit-2
    2 days ago

    PANTS_ON_FIRE,

  • gapa@feddit.nu
    link
    fedilink
    arrow-up
    12
    ·
    2 days ago

    Needs more emojis.

    • FunkyCheese@lemmy.dbzer0.com
      cake
      link
      fedilink
      English
      arrow-up
      12
      ·
      2 days ago

      👍 = true

      • rustydrd@sh.itjust.works
        link
        fedilink
        arrow-up
        17
        ·
        edit-2
        2 days ago

        👎 = false
        🫳 = maybe
        🤌 = Italian false

  • bitjunkie@lemmy.world
    link
    fedilink
    arrow-up
    4
    ·
    2 days ago

    I’d have gone with “truthy” and “falsy”, but I like the cut of the jib all the same

  • luciole (they/them)@beehaw.org
    link
    fedilink
    arrow-up
    4
    ·
    2 days ago

    megabool is_boy(const Coder *coder);

  • SaharaMaleikuhm@feddit.org
    link
    fedilink
    arrow-up
    3
    ·
    2 days ago

    Damn JavaScript

  • 33550336@lemmy.world
    link
    fedilink
    arrow-up
    1
    ·
    2 days ago

    This is just reinvention of Łukasiewicz multi-valued logic

  • ranzispa@mander.xyz
    link
    fedilink
    arrow-up
    2
    ·
    2 days ago

    I’m confused as to the use of double true.

    I’ve been running a query adding TRUE entries to other TRUE entries, but I just get TRUE as result.

Programmer Humor@programming.dev

programmer_humor@programming.dev

Subscribe from Remote Instance

Create a post
You are not logged in. However you can subscribe from another Fediverse account, for example Lemmy or Mastodon. To do this, paste the following into the search field of your instance: !programmer_humor@programming.dev

Welcome to Programmer Humor!

This is a place where you can post jokes, memes, humor, etc. related to programming!

For sharing awful code theres also Programming Horror.

Rules

  • Keep content in english
  • No advertisements
  • Posts must be related to programming or programmer topics
Visibility: Public
globe

This community can be federated to other instances and be posted/commented in by their users.

  • 1.45K users / day
  • 2.48K users / week
  • 7.63K users / month
  • 17.5K users / 6 months
  • 1 local subscriber
  • 31.9K subscribers
  • 1.86K Posts
  • 55.6K Comments
  • Modlog
  • mods:
  • adr1an@programming.dev
  • Feyter@programming.dev
  • BurningTurtle@programming.dev
  • Pierre-Yves Lapersonne@programming.dev
  • BE: 0.19.12
  • Modlog
  • Instances
  • Docs
  • Code
  • join-lemmy.org